I do not own Mortal Kombat Armageddon, for a variety of reasons, but recently i thought of something that might be interesting: Taven's face dragon tatoo is surely based on the facial tatoos that the Black Dragon Grandmasters had in Mortal Kombat Conquest.

I mean...

Taven from Mortal Kombat Armageddon (Daegon's facial tatoo is similar, but on the other side of his face)




Bannak (former Grandmaster of the Black Dragon clan)
from Mortal Kombat Conquest




And Kebral (Bannak's son, and leader of the clan after his father's death)



This is quite strange, because Daegon also has this kind of facial tatoo, and yet he formed the Red Dragon Clan, plus is and always was the Red Dragon Clan's Grandmaster, while Bannak and Kebral, though non-canonical MK characters, were both Grandmasters of the Black Dragon Clan centuries ago.

Maybe Midway used these tatoos in Armageddon as a homage to the series... or maybe not (most probably not).

Probably a coincidence.

The whole story of the Red Dragon clan (how it states that the Black Dragon clan was a group of Red Dragon that rebelled against them and formed their own clan, THIS CENTURY) completely contradicts what MK Conquest did, by stating that the Black Dragon clan was around centuries ago. Mentioning or referencing any of the MK Conquest Black Dragon characters in the game would make no sense, and only serve to highlight the contradiction.
